Ipsos Net Income Growth & History (IPS)
Ipsos's net income was €188.4M for fiscal 2025.
View full Ipsos company overviewIpsos annual net income history
| Fiscal year | Period ended | Net income | Change | Growth |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2025 | 2025-12-31 | €188.4M | −€21.2M | −10.12% |
| 2024 | 2024-12-31 | €209.6M | €44.1M | +26.62% |
| 2023 | 2023-12-31 | €165.5M | −€55.1M | −24.96% |
| 2022 | 2022-12-31 | €220.6M | €33.5M | +17.88% |
| 2021 | 2021-12-31 | €187.1M | €77.2M | +70.19% |
| 2020 | 2020-12-31 | €110.0M | — | — |
Ipsos net income trends
Over the last five fiscal years, Ipsos's net income increased from €110.0M to €188.4M, a change of €78.4M.
What net income means
Net income is a company’s bottom-line profit or loss after operating costs, interest, taxes, and other reported income and expenses. It shows how much of a company’s revenue ultimately remained as earnings, or how large its loss was, during a fiscal period.
